Top 15 Cable Sports Events: September 24-25, 2016

College football continues to rule the weekend sports programming, filling the top three spots of the weekend, and seven of the top 15 on the chart. The early evening game, featuring LSU and AUBURN, collected 4.1 million viewers and a 1.3 rating in Adults 18-49. The Texas AM v Arkansas game that followed, ranked second overall, with 3.9 million viewers and the same 1.3 demo rating.

The NASCAR Chase race ranked 4th on the weekend, bringing in 2.5 million viewers for NBC Sports Network, on Sunday afternoon. The Xfiinity race (#8) and the Truck Race (#14) also made this week's top 15 chart.
